Abstract / Description: Five species of Antarctic euphausiid crustaceans were studied from the Antarctic ... Peninsula and the south-eastern Weddell Sea. Life spans range from two years for Euphausia frigida to six ... years for the krill Euphausia superba. Growth in length and weight was calculated by non-linear ... toothfish (Dissostichus eleginoides) in the Crozet and Kerguelen Islands Exclusive Economic Zones (EEZs ... ) between 2003 and 2005. In the Crozet EEZ, the reported interactions involved killer whales and sperm ... whales. These two species, alone or in co-occurrence with each other, were observed in 71% of the 1 308 ... longlines set. In the Kerguelen EEZ, the reported interactions involved sperm whales and fur seals.
